Output c666d3ed24f637d3e4ba233186f5d8a70366cd063a0773e4e23ac62f16da6542:0

value
1035244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f117584212910815b4b8113cbe7ea8da57cae1a OP_EQUAL
address
38u6DmrnQ68tZMYP62SHbbbBeY9zgCVUeD
transaction
c666d3ed24f637d3e4ba233186f5d8a70366cd063a0773e4e23ac62f16da6542
spent
true